WebMay 18, 2024 · Go to the ‘Home’ tab, click the ‘Fill’ command on the Ribbon and select ‘Series’ option. In the Series dialog box, select where you want to fill the cells, ‘Columns’ or ‘Rows’; in the Type section, select ‘Linear’; and in the Step value, enter the start value (1) and in stop value, enter the end value (eg, 500).
